Below is the definitive legend for every button on the new ZH LW03 remote control.
| Button Symbol | Function | Description |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Power (⚫) | On/Off | Turns the connected LED lights or device on/off. Saves the last color/mode. | | RED (R) | Static Red | Sets output to pure red (255,0,0). | | GREEN (G) | Static Green | Sets output to pure green (0,255,0). | | BLUE (B) | Static Blue | Sets output to pure blue (0,0,255). | | WHITE (W) | Pure White | Activates all RGB channels to produce cool white (for RGBW strips). | | ORANGE / YELLOW | Pastel Color | Sets a warm pastel orange/yellow hue (3000K simulation). | | PURPLE | Magenta | Mix of red and blue channels. | | CYAN | Aqua | Mix of green and blue channels. | | UP (▲) | Brightness + | Increases brightness in 5% increments. | | DOWN (▼) | Brightness - | Decreases brightness. | | MODE (M) | Auto / Demo | Cycles through 20+ dynamic modes (flash, strobe, fade, smooth). | | SPEED + (S+) | Mode Speed Up | Increases the transition speed of flashing/fading modes. | | SPEED - (S-) | Mode Speed Down | Decreases the transition speed. | | DIY 1 / DIY 2 | Custom Preset | Save your current color/mode (Press for 3 seconds to save, short press to recall). |

Even with a new ZH LW03 remote, issues can arise. Consult this manual section before returning the product.
| Problem | Likely Cause |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Remote does nothing | Batteries dead or polarity wrong. | Replace batteries. Check +/- signs. | | Only works 1 foot away | Low battery voltage or signal interference. | Replace batteries. Move Wi-Fi router away from receiver. | | Lights flicker randomly | Pairing conflict with another remote. | Perform Master Reset (Section 3.3) and re-pair only one remote. | | Buttons feel stuck | Debris under rubber membrane. | Gently pry keypad (with remote off) and clean with isopropyl alcohol. | | Works, but no white color | Your LED strip is RGB only (not RGBW). | The White button will not work on an RGB strip. |
